The Association for the Improvement of American Infrastructure (AIAI) is a non-profit organization formed in the District of Columbia to help shape the direction of the national Public Private Partnership marketplace. AIAI serves as a national proponent to facilitate education and legislation through targeted advocacy. AIAI believes that effective and well-planned education can provide civic leaders with the knowledge they need to make informed decisions about the benefits of public private partnerships: economic development, life cycle cost savings, risk transfer and accelerated project delivery. We aim to shape a better America through the success and growth of our industry through job creation and providing a platform for the exchange of innovative ideas. AIAI's Board is comprised of leaders of the construction and development industry. Their extensive national and international experience and industry knowledge provides AIAI with a clear direction for developing and advocating policy and legislative solutions, allowing more equitable and effective partnerships across diverse market sectors from transportation and energy to educational, health and public service institutions.

As we face increasing demands on our infrastructure, public-private partnerships (P3s) have proven to be a powerful tool for delivering critical projects that not only improve mobility but also drive economic growth. We’re proud of our role in leading the way with innovative solutions like the TEXpress Lanes in Dallas-Fort Worth—a model that is making a real difference in how we build and sustain infrastructure. We’ve successfully replicated this model in other states, such as North Carolina and Virginia and we are glad to see that more States are adopting this model for the delivery of major transportation programs in urban areas.
